The regional side of political communication. Corning back on the diffusion of an expertise.
Jean-Baptiste Legavre [76-99]
Communication and opinion poil techniques are spreading in the regions. The situations are diverse, and the area remains blurred but institutionalization is getting obvious. It is, therefore, useful to corne back on the explanations provided by academic specialists in this matter on the origins of this diffusion. Eventually, even if ten or so assumptions can be spotted in scientific works, there are three dominant «paradigms» : the first one puts an emphasis on the technique, the second one on the actors, the third on institutionnal rules. It is, however, useful to «reframe» these paradigms in order to show the mistakes they encompass, all the more so since they take up a view of the regional level that may not provide a good apprehension of its specific logics.
